OB profile rejected for crucial battle against FCK - after breach of the club's values
Jay-Roy Grot has been dropped from OB's squad for the upcoming match against FC Copenhagen due to a breach of team rules during training.
OB has announced that striker Jay-Roy Grot will not be included in the squad for their crucial Superliga clash against FC Copenhagen on Saturday. The decision follows an incident during Wednesday's training session where Grot violated the team's established values and rules. OB's management emphasized the importance of adhering to these principles as foundational to the club’s identity and teamwork.
Grot, who has scored seven goals this season in the Superliga, has been a key player for the squad. However, this disciplinary action reflects OB's commitment to maintaining standards of conduct among its players. The club's statement highlighted that violations of team rules would not be tolerated, and ensuring player accountability is essential for the team's overall performance and unity.
With the match approaching, both OB and FC Copenhagen are vying for crucial points to secure their positions in the top half of the league table. As it stands, FCK is positioned at seventh and OB at eighth, making this encounter vital for both teams' hopes of entering the championship play-offs, intensifying the competitive stakes of the upcoming fixture.
